Subject: On-call handover — Scanline integration

Hi Priya,

Welcome to the rotation. The Scanline barcode integration at Verdano Logistics occasionally drops frames when the warehouse scanners reconnect after a network blip. If you see duplicate SKU events, check the dedupe window config before restarting the bridge service — restarts reset the sequence counter and can mask the real issue. Please review any config change as carefully as code. The full triage checklist lives on the internal page below.

dashboard of bafof-hafog = https://confluence.lumiclabs.internal/display/browse/display/6a09a20a

RUNBOOK — Medical Cooler Run, Section 7

Quick refresher for the records crew: the cooler heading to the Ashvale field clinic carries temperature-sensitive vaccine stock from the Pellmore depot, so the clock matters. Pre-chill the cooler two hours before load, drop in both data loggers, and note the start temperature on the transit card. Don't stack anything on the lid, ever. If the run is delayed more than ninety minutes, call the clinic coordinator before the courier departs. The hand-over instruction for the courier follows below.

courier memo of yawep-yafog: the pramir ulaix courier leaves the ulavan aldix frair zorok oliiel joreth rusdor fenvan ledger at gate 1305 under passcode 514738

Changed defaults in Splitfork, our assignment service. Bucketing now uses sticky hashing per account instead of per session, and the holdout slice grew from 2% to 5%. Callers relying on session-level reassignment must opt in explicitly. Review the diff against the new baseline; the updated default configuration is listed below.

config for tagep-kajof:
[casir]
port = 6379
region = south-1
host = casir.paliqdyn.example
team = tamax
timeout_ms = 250
retries = 2